We show that flux qubits can be efficiently entangled by inductive coupling to a tunable resonant circuit, in the scheme reminiscent of atoms’ entanglement through the optical cavity mode. It is shown, in particular, that the singlephoton excitation of the resonator produces the pure Bell state of qubits with the completely disentangled LC circuit. 03.67.Lx; 85.25.Cp; 03.65.Ud Typeset using REVTEX

Coherent coupling of two qubits mediated by a nonlinear resonator is studied. It is shown that the amount of entanglement accessible in the evolution depends on both the strength of nonlinearity in the Hamiltonian of the resonator and on the initial preparation of the system. The created entanglement survives in the presence of decoherence.
